In this example, the system language is ELangCanadianEnglish and
there is no exact match of the resource file on the system. The application
calls BaflUtils::NearestLanguageFileV2() to get the closest
match. There are three available resource files:

The filename parameter is updated as "c:\\FileMenu.r10" which
is the closest resource file for ELangCanadianEnglish. The lang parameter
is returned as ELangAmerican (value 10) which is the nearest
equivalent language.
